所有文件均在E:路径下。
安装jdk1.6.0_07
安装了VC++6.0
第一步,
HelloWorld.java
第二步,
E:>javac HelloWorld.java
得到
HelloWorld.class
第三步,
E:>javah HelloWorld
得到
HelloWorld.h
第四步,
编写一个C文件
HelloWorldImp.c
第五步,
使用cl编译
第六步,
我成功了
后来继续试验,目标是Java调用打印机的tsclib.dll,方法是dll调用dll:建立中间dll,兼顾Jni方法,调用tsclib.dll实现动作。(提前告诉您结果:我失败了)
------------------------下面有源码:
本文来自CSDN博客,转载请标明出处:http://blog.csdn.net/pinkPumpkins/archive/2009/12/18/5029199.aspx
-